Overview
Infinity at Brickell occupies a prime location close to shopping and dining with appealing rooftop views, attractive common areas, and a functional pool and gym setup. The community features unique loft units and a generally quieter atmosphere compared to the immediate center of Brickell. However, recent experiences point to ongoing challenges with management responsiveness, communication issues, and noticeable declines in common area upkeep and elevator reliability. Noise transmission between units and occasional parking and valet concerns also require attention from property operations.

Does Infinity at Brickell, a Condo require a milestone inspection?
Yes — as a building of three or more stories it is within the class covered by Florida SB 4-D milestone inspections. This is a factual classification about the building class; Aedificio does not publish whether an inspection is complete or overdue.
Can you get a mortgage on a condo here?
Condo mortgage eligibility depends on the project's "warrantability" (Fannie Mae / Freddie Mac criteria: owner-occupancy, reserves, litigation, insurance). Aedificio surfaces the public inputs; your lender makes the warrantability determination.
